Coldest Day In North Dakota . On february 15, 1936, 87 years ago today, north dakota had its lowest temperature of record, 60 degrees below zero recorded in parshall,. During this month, temperatures frequently fall. January is historically the coldest month in north dakota. Winter is a grand season to many north dakotans.
